This podcast explores the stories of champions of food procurement.

Brought to you by the UN One Planet Network and ICLEI - Local Governments for Sustainability, each episode unpacks how public authorities from around the world leverage procurement to positively impact the food value chain, to ultimately contribute to sustainable food systems.

    Copenhagen: how food can become a game changer

    Copenhagen: how food can become a game changer

    In this last episode of this series, we talk to Betina Bergmann Madsen about Copenhagen’s journey towards sustainable public food procurement. Betina shares her first hand experience as a public procurer of food, how to create dialogue with the market and kitchen staff towards 100% organic food, and the importance of exchanging experience and collaborating across different levels of government. She also gives some great practical recommendations and inspiring food for thought for fellow procurers.

    Manta: how to scale-up local food procurement

    Manta: how to scale-up local food procurement

    In this episode, our guest Mirian Johanna Zambrano Benavides talks to us about pioneering local food procurement in the city of  Manta, Ecuador.

    Her work as a Project Coordinator of the Feeding Urbanization FAO Ecuador Project is remarkable as it is the first time food is procured through local government, not through the usual centralised system in Ecuador. Our guest talks about Manta’s exemplary approach to healthy food access, building relationships with local farmers and the plans to replicate the model to other cities in the country.

    Addis Ababa: School Feeding in Women’s Hands

    Addis Ababa: School Feeding in Women’s Hands

    In this episode we explore the exemplary food public procurement system in Addis Ababa, Ethiopia, with the help of advisor to the city mayor on nutrition and board member of the school feeding agency Meti Tamrat.

    This episode gives the listeners a good insight into a multi-sectoral approach to procurement, with a focus on local employment of women, more specifically of the mothers of school children. As a matter of fact, the programme works with a catering system based on training the mothers on nutritional value, health and sustainability of different foods, and letting them cook.

    The successful implementation of this programme was able to contribute to the sustainable development goals of zero hunger, quality of education, gender equality, good health and wellbeing, despite the challenges the COVID-19 pandemic presented.

    Minneapolis and the GFPP: Sustainable food is a choice - Part 2

    Minneapolis and the GFPP: Sustainable food is a choice - Part 2

    In this episode we dive deep into the public food procurement process in the USA, with the help of our guests Alexa Delwiche, Co-founder and Director of the Center for Good Food Purchasing, and Bertrand Weber, Director for Minneapolis Public School Culinary and Wellness Services.

    This episode gives a deeper insight into the relationship between public procurement processes, the bigger picture of the American federal system and the United States Department of Agriculture and its regulations. The guests also give some powerful advice to other procurers, finishing off with their words of wisdom.

    Italy: How good food brings everyone together at one table

    Italy: How good food brings everyone together at one table

    In this episode we take a closer look at Italy’s food procurement system and legislation, which is particular for its mandatory green public procurement criteria including food and catering contracts.

    Our inspiring guests are Sabina Nicolella, Alberta Congeduti and Matteo Gordini, from Fondazione Ecosistemi, an Italian organisation working on strategies, programmes and actions for sustainable development in the country.
